clone 896644 -1
reassign -1 lam: lam alternatives break openmpi/mpich
thanks
Hi,
This is due to lam not supporting the updated semantics for the mpi
alternatives. The MPI alternatives in openmpi (default mpi) and mpich
now honour multiarch, and the existing mpi alternatives in LAM need to
be updated to do so.
Alternatively, Lam could be removed (officially dead upstream since 2015
https://blogs.cisco.com/performance/a-farewell-to-lammpi)
Regards
Alastair
On 12/02/2019 23:04, Ivo De Decker wrote:
Control: reopen -1
Hi,
On Fri, Apr 20, 2018 at 06:56:24PM +0300, Adrian Bunk wrote:
[...]
Setting up openmpi-bin (3.0.1-6) ...
update-alternatives: using /usr/bin/mpirun.openmpi to provide /usr/bin/mpirun
(mpirun) in auto mode
update-alternatives: error: /var/lib/dpkg/alternatives/mpi corrupt: slave link
same as main link /usr/bin/mpicc
dpkg: error processing package openmpi-bin (--configure):
installed openmpi-bin package post-installation script subprocess returned
error exit status 2
It seems this issue is back in builds for netpipe:
https://buildd.debian.org/status/fetch.php?pkg=netpipe&arch=amd64&ver=3.7.2-7.4%2Bb5&stamp=1550010019&raw=0
Setting up openmpi-bin (3.1.3-10) ...
update-alternatives: using /usr/bin/mpirun.openmpi to provide /usr/bin/mpirun
(mpirun) in auto mode
update-alternatives: error: /var/lib/dpkg/alternatives/mpi corrupt: slave link
same as main link /usr/bin/mpicc
dpkg: error processing package openmpi-bin (--configure):
installed openmpi-bin package post-installation script subprocess returned
error exit status 2
Ivo
--
Alastair McKinstry, <[email protected]>, <[email protected]>,
https://diaspora.sceal.ie/u/amckinstry
Misentropy: doubting that the Universe is becoming more disordered.